Incredibly Tasty Udon Noodles: A Speedy Delight for Your Palate

Preparing a delightful bowl of udon noodles is as simple as soaking the noodles while toasting pine nuts and stir-frying a combination of ginger, garlic, and spring onions. This quick and satisfying carbohydrate-packed dish has become my go-to emergency dinner—it’s easy to whip up in just a matter of minutes. In my kitchen, cherry tomatoes are a staple on the worktop, and I always keep miso and spring onions stocked in the fridge. After experimenting with various types of noodles, I’ve concluded that the best choice for this dish is the thick and delightfully chewy udon variety. Don’t fret if you’re out of pine nuts; a sprinkle of chopped salted peanuts serves as an excellent alternative topping.
